Digital Slr Camera Sensor Cleaning




Dslr camera sensor cleaning is a bit of a mystery. A black art if you like. I'm not entirely sure it deserved to be because if you are smart adequate to use a Dslr, you're smart adequate to take off sensor dust. The only issue is you may not be able to due to time, confidence or being in possession of the right tool such as the illustrated dust arctic butterfly.

It needs to be tackled determined though, and with the right tool for the sensor size which you have. This you need to be aware of as it dictate the type of swab you use.

Another strangeness worth pointing out with 'sensor cleaning' is that you don't verily clean the camera sensor. You clean a thin piece of glass (for want of a best word) which sits over the sensor. This is called the low-pass filter. Its a delicate limited thing but not as delicate as a dslr camera sensor.

Another thing to point out before you start is make sure you have a memory card in the camera, because you will need to take test shots, and make sure you have a fully charged battery. You do not want it powering off while you're performing your camera cleaning because a mirror shutting down on top of a sensor swab or an arctic butterfly can prove to be an high-priced mistake. This goes for either you're using a pro service or if you are cleaning your own sensor.

So now you have the right tool to hand and you have you're camera all ready to go you might think about laying your hands on a Sensor loupe. This acts as a scope (lit magnifying glass in other words) for you to clearly see any dirt, sensor dust or smears on your sensor.

A perfect list of the tool you should have to hand is. Sensor Loupe, Sensor swab for your sensor size, illustrated Dust Arctic Butterfly, Hurricane Blower, lint free cloth, fully charged battery in your camera, memory card (for test shots) and a steady hand (ok, and perhaps a lenspen as a general Slr cleaning tool, but not imperative by any stretch of the imagination)
